Learning Outcomes and Competencies
The projects for the minor practicals are offered in various subject groups focusing on research in the areas of food chemistry and processing, cell culture and tissue engineering, aroma science and food fermentation.
The work involves independent literature research, planning, and execution of experimental approaches to address specific problems, with support from instructors and scientific staff.
